The investor: The choking gun

Article Abstract:

The former Australian holding company, James Hardie Industries Ltd, was known since 2001 as ABN 60, its Australian business number. James Hardie the chief financial officer unsuccessfully tried to persuade the Medical Research and Compensation Foundation to take ABN 60 into Amaca.

Pipedream bursts

Article Abstract:

Excessive use of power affected the metropolitan power system and resulted in the ban of non-essential power. The sale of North-West Shelf natural gas pipeline followed by the problems plaguing the buyout of the pipeline and the calling off of the loan by the bank is presented.

Brain sell: An Australian start-up is creating a database of the brain's workings that may help revolutionize the global drug industry

Article Abstract:

The creation of a database by the Australian psychiatrists to understand the working of brain is described. Its use in understanding severe mental disorders like schizophrenia and dementia is examined.
